Network uptime is paramount. Release 15.2(2)E9 resolves edge-case bugs related to Power over Ethernet (PoE) allocation, unexpected switch reboots during high broadcast traffic, and stacking instabilities on FlexStack modules. 3. Comprehensive Layer 2 and Layer 3 Features

This version is used in mixed-stack environments; for instance, a 2960-S member in a stack with 2960-X switches often requires specific IOS versions like this one for compatibility . "c2960s-universalk9-tar.152-2.e9.tar" file is the final software image for Cisco's Catalyst 2960-S switch series. This TAR archive contains the Cisco IOS® 15.2(2)E9 universal image—the last officially released firmware for this now-end-of-life platform.
